Basically the concept is:

  • 60* people send in X amount of money (and can donate extra sleeves if they want). Maybe $50.
  • One person buys the sleeves, with some level of feedback from participants**
  • That person sends them out to everyone who paid

*maybe fewer initially, to hold back spares in case of lost packages
**This can be discussed. Realistically the buyer can’t run every purchase past every participant, but there should be some consensus of the direction they’ll take

I’ve had a couple of other messages so to add context: some of the packs of sleeves run into three figures, so instead of buying one pack to get the art and trying to figure out what to do with the rest, you can get a variety.

Example:
60 people each send in $50, leaving $3000 to buy sleeves. If the average price of a pack is something like $20-30, you would expect to get 100 unique sleeves in return.

Those numbers are all open to feedback.
